解决本地文件上传时fakepath的问题
直接上例子
这个例子是用jqery操作的事件,注意引入jquery
- HTML代码
<div class="demo"><img width="200px">
<input type="file"/>
</div>
- JavaScript代码
$("input[type='file']").on('change', function () {
var myFReader = new FileReader();
var file = document.getElementById('input-file').files[0];
myFReader.readAsDataURL(file);
myFReader.onloadend = function(evc){
var src = evc.target.result;
$('img').attr('src',src);
alert(src);
}
});